Lima Alliance last Sunday equaled the series of the National Final of the Peruvian Volleyball League, with a resounding victory against the San Martin University.
The blue and white won with a score of 3-0 in sets with partials of 25-18, 25-22 and 25-22.

In this way, the Saints lost their undefeated record this season and everything will be decided in the third game.
This decisive match will be played next Sunday at the Villa El Salvador Sports Center.
As we remember, the white club defeated Alianza in the first final with a more than exciting outcome, since the blue and white team had a 14-11 lead in the fifth set that was finally overcome.
